Q: Is 5,352,568 a Composite Number?

 A: Yes, 5,352,568 is a composite number.

Why is 5,352,568 a composite number?

A composite number is a number that can be divided evenly by more numbers than 1 and itself. It is the opposite of a prime number.

The number 5,352,568 can be evenly divided by 1 2 4 8 13 26 37 52 74 104 107 148 169 214 296 338 428 481 676 856 962 1,352 1,391 1,924 2,782 3,848 3,959 5,564 6,253 7,918 11,128 12,506 15,836 18,083 25,012 31,672 36,166 50,024 51,467 72,332 102,934 144,664 205,868 411,736 669,071 1,338,142 2,676,284 and 5,352,568, with no remainder.

Since 5,352,568 cannot be divided by just 1 and 5,352,568, it is a composite number.
